Get ones with the velcro strap around the ankle - MUCH better at keeping water from flushing in and out, and avoids the balloon-full-of-water effect at the bottom of your legs :shock:

No doubt someone will disagree with me, but the split toe ones are uncomfortable, and the big toe gets chilly 'cos its isolated all on its own :?
